Actually, the original D&D rulebook never listed a colour for orcs. Later, with 'The Orcs of Thar' Gazetteer, it listed orcs as pink, brown, black, or grey-greenish skin, sometimes with spots. Then there were also orcs with white, light grey, copper, or reddish skin.:)

No green goblins in D&D though (that I know of).
